Beyond the KTEA-3 and its reliance on Kaufman Cards, several robust achievement tests provide alternative assessment options․ The Woodcock-Johnson IV Tests of Achievement (WJ IV) is a widely respected choice, offering a comprehensive evaluation across various academic domains․ Similarly, the Wechsler Individual Achievement Test – Third Edition (WIAT-III) provides a detailed assessment of reading, math, and written language skills․

Furthermore, the Brigance Inventory of Early Literacy Skills III is valuable for younger learners, while the Stanford Achievement Test Series offers a broader, curriculum-based assessment․ When selecting an alternative, consider the specific needs of the student and the purpose of the evaluation, ensuring alignment with relevant educational goals and standards․ A PDF format may be available for some of these tests․

Considerations When Choosing an Assessment

Selecting the right achievement test, even with readily available Kaufman Cards PDF resources, requires careful thought․ Consider the student’s age, grade level, and suspected learning difficulties․ The assessment’s scope – whether broad or focused – must align with the referral question․

Furthermore, evaluate the test’s psychometric properties, including reliability and validity․ Practical factors like administration time, scoring complexity, and cost are also crucial․ Ensure the chosen test is culturally and linguistically appropriate for the student․ A digital PDF version should not compromise these essential considerations․
